Here are the details on the car........srt8 magnum with ported heads, Hennessey cold air induction, headers, cats, 1st resonator delete, and STOCK cam. We wanted to see just how good the stock cam would preform and from the testing it is a nice grind but our custom grind will for sure pick it up a lot more.The car made 368 bone stock and 390 prior to the head swap. We also have a set of heads that flow 20 cfm more than what is on this car now. I will post up the dyno sheets later. Anyone interested can contact Hennessey Performance 281-346-1370
